1. A method for controlling a turbomachine equipped with a gas generator comprising, respectively, low-pressure and high-pressure, rotation shafts, the turbomachine including at least one electric machine forming a device for injecting/taking-off power onto/from at least one shaft of the rotation shafts, said method including steps included in a control loop and comprising:
determining, for the at least one shaft of the rotation shafts and as a function of a rating setpoint associated with said at least one shaft of the rotation shafts, of a variation dU of a mechanical power command,
determining, for the at least one electric machine and as a function of an injection/take-off setpoint associated with said at least one electric machine, of a variation dPelec of a power injection/take-off command,
determining of a multivariable command including a fuel flow rate component as well as a power injection/take-off component for each electric machine, said multivariable command being determined to:
optimize a constraint of tracking of said variations dU and dPelec,
observe operating limits of the turbomachine.
